Wigan’s prospective takeover is off after the Spanish bidder reduced their offer by almost 50 per cent. The statement read: “As of 11am today, the administrators have broken off negotiations with the Spanish bidder. The statement continued: “Over this weekend we received a letter from the bidder reducing the bid by almost 50 per cent. This would result in a 15-point deduction and would effectively relegate the club to League Two. Under the EFL insolvency policy, this is not possible and the deal is therefore unable to be concluded.
